DS Audio bringt DiskStation zum Absturz

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Hallo,

Ich nutze seit einigen Monaten die DS Audio App auf einem Android-Smartphone. Funktioniert super. Was mir jedoch auffällt ist, wenn ich eine Playliste zum Download markiere und den Downloadfortschritt in der App beobachte bringt dies meine Diskstation zum "Absturz" bzw. alle Webdienste hängen sich auf. Der Download am Handy stoppt ebenfalls. Ich kann dann warten (15Minuten) oder das NAS komplett neu starten.
Lasse ich den Download der Musik im Hintergrund laufen, gibt es weder einen Abstürz, noch einen Abbruch des Downloads.

Im Ressourcen-Monitor unter Prozesse erscheinen unzählige "cover.cgi" Einträge, wenn ich die Download-Liste offen habe. Läuft die "DS App" im
Hintergrund, sind keine dieser Prozesse zu sehen.

Kann jemand ein ähnliches Verhalten beobachten?

Danke,
Martin
 

ctrlaltdelete

Benutzer
Contributor
Sehr erfahren
Maintainer
Mitglied seit
30. Dez 2012
Beiträge
13.633
Punkte für Reaktionen
5.809
Punkte
524
Welche DS, DSM?
 

plang.pl

Benutzer
Contributor
Sehr erfahren
Mitglied seit
28. Okt 2020
Beiträge
15.028
Punkte für Reaktionen
5.401
Punkte
564

plang.pl

Benutzer
Contributor
Sehr erfahren
Mitglied seit
28. Okt 2020
Beiträge
15.028
Punkte für Reaktionen
5.401
Punkte
564
Welche Versionen hast du genau installiert? Also welche DSM und welche AudioStation Version?
Steht was im Protokoll-Center?
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
DSM ist "6.2.4-25556 Update 7". Audio Station Version müsste die aktuellste "6.5.7 - 3383" sein. Kann ich später jedoch nachschauen und ggf. ausbessern.

Im Protokoll-Center nicht, aber im System-Log und dem Log-File der Audio Station sieht man, wie die Dienste abstürzen. Kann ich ggf. später posten. Das Problem lässt sich ja wunderbar nachstellen.
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Die Angaben zur DSM-Version und zur Audio Station sind korrekt.
Ich habe vorhin einige Songs zu einer Playlist hinzugefügt und den Download gestartet. Kurze Zeit später sind unter den Prozessen unzählige cover.cgi Einträge zu sehen und die DiskStation hängt sich auf wenn ich den Download am Handy weiter beobachte. CPU-Auslastung sieht man rechts.

cover cgi Prozesse.png


Im Protokoll-Center wird davon nichts aufgezeichnet. Öffne ich den "Aufgaben"-Screen am Smartphone nicht, läuft der Download im Hintergrund und DSM normal weiter.

Im Messages.log wiederholen sich in der Zeit folgende Einträge (Blockweise):
2023-08-06T20:39:41+02:00 [HOSNAME ENTFERNT] tag_editor.cgi: audiolyrics.cpp:321 Failed to mkdir [/volume1/music/@eaDir/@tmp]
2023-08-06T20:39:42+02:00 [HOSNAME ENTFERNT] tag_editor.cgi: audiolyrics.cpp:321 Failed to mkdir [/volume1/music/@eaDir/@tmp]
2023-08-06T20:39:44+02:00 [HOSNAME ENTFERNT] tag_editor.cgi: audiolyrics.cpp:321 Failed to mkdir [/volume1/music/@eaDir/@tmp]
2023-08-06T20:40:07+02:00 [HOSNAME ENTFERNT] tag_editor.cgi: SYSTEM: Last message 'audiolyrics.cpp:321 ' repeated 19 times, suppressed by syslog-ng on [HOSNAME ENTFERNT]
2023-08-06T20:40:07+02:00 S010DS212 : SCGIServer.hpp:234 child 20336 exited with code 1

In den anderen System- und App-Logs sind zur betreffenden Zeit entweder keine oder nicht zutreffende Einträge.

Meine Vermutung wäre, dass der Auslöser das Laden der Cover-Bilder in der DS App ist. Was meint ihr?

Zum Smartphone:
Huawei P20 Pro, Android 10, DS Audio App 3.15.4-524
 

Thonav

Benutzer
Sehr erfahren
Mitglied seit
16. Feb 2014
Beiträge
7.890
Punkte für Reaktionen
1.510
Punkte
274
Ich verstehe immer noch nicht Deine Vorgehensweise?! Welche Playlist lädst Du von wo runter - und wofür?
Ich erstelle eine Playlist in Synology Audio am Handy und die App spielt mir die Lieder in der gewünschten Reihenfolge. Da wird gar nichts runtergeladen.
Download der Lieder gibt es doch nur, wenn ich die Lieder lokal sichern will um, falls nicht im Wlan, diese dann auch abspielen zu können.
Aber vielleicht bin ich ja auch der Einzige der es nicht versteht.
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Hallo Thonav,

Ich stelle mir eine Playlist zusammen und sichere diese dann lokal weil ich, genau wie vermutet, nicht immer im WLAN bin. Beim Herunterladen dieser Playlist hängt sich die Diskstation auf weil die cover.cgi Prozesse das System auslasten.

Aber eben nur, wenn ich den "Aufgaben" Screen in der App offen habe. Screenshot_20230806_204316_com.synology.DSaudio.jpg

Man sieht, es werden die ersten Cover schnell geladen und dann hängt das System.

Meine Frage wäre, ob die etlichen cover.cgi Prozesse auf neueren DiskStations reproduzierbar ist.
 

Thonav

Benutzer
Sehr erfahren
Mitglied seit
16. Feb 2014
Beiträge
7.890
Punkte für Reaktionen
1.510
Punkte
274
Wo sicherst Du die lokal? Die Lieder sollen dann heruntergeladen werden, wenn Du nicht im Wlan bist? Ich würde es ja gerne für Dich nachstellen, aber es ist mir immer noch nicht klar. Habe selber hier nur iPhones, weiß also auch nicht, ob ich es überhaupt nachstellen kann.
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Gesichert werden die Titel in einem Standardordner der App. Wird sicher ein anderer sein als bei iOS.

Während ich die Titel herunterlade, befinde ich mich natürlich im selben Netzwerk wie mein NAS. Danach starte ich die App offline und wähle die heruntergeladenen Playlisten zum Abspielen aus. Das funktioniert auch alles problemlos.

Wenn ich im selben Netz bin, wie meine DS habe ich in der DS Audio App die Möglichkeit, eine komplette Playlist herunterzuladen. Wird bei iOS wahrscheinlich nicht anders ein. Daraufhin kann ich aus den App-Benachrichtigungen den "Aufgaben"-Screen öffnen und sehe den Fortschritt der Downloads (das Bild oben). Lasse ich diesen Screen offen, hängt sich das NAS komplett auf. Webzugriff ist daraufhin nicht mehr möglich.

Öffne ich genau diesen Aufgaben-Screen nicht, gibt es kein Problem. Für mich habe ich einen Workaround. Wäre aber interessant ob das nur meine Kombination DS212+ DSM 6.2 in Verbindung mit Android 10,... trifft oder auch andere Systeme.
 

Thonav

Benutzer
Sehr erfahren
Mitglied seit
16. Feb 2014
Beiträge
7.890
Punkte für Reaktionen
1.510
Punkte
274
Also - ich habe im WLAN am iPhone eine neue Wiedergabeliste erstellt - dieser habe ich dann 20 Lieder hinzugefügt und abschließend diese Wiedergabeliste heruntergeladen. Die Wiedergabeliste wird dann als "heruntergeladen Wiedergabeliste" in der App dargestellt und enthält alle 20 Lieder, die jetzt auf dem Iphone liegen.
 

Synchrotron

Benutzer
Sehr erfahren
Mitglied seit
13. Jul 2019
Beiträge
5.096
Punkte für Reaktionen
2.065
Punkte
259
Keine Ahnung, noch so ein Apfel-Jünger.

Eines kann ich aber sicher sagen: Ich denke, der Synology-Support wird angesichts der Sammlung veralteter Betriebssysteme nur die Schultern Zucken und sagen „Erst mal Updates einspielen“. DSM 6.2 steht vor dem Supportende, Android 10 ist ziemlich Vintage.

Vielleicht findest du tatsächlich hier jemanden, der ähnlich weit zurück unterwegs ist, und dann auch noch Audio Station zum offline-Download zu motivieren versucht - wäre ein Glückstreffer.
 

plang.pl

Benutzer
Contributor
Sehr erfahren
Mitglied seit
28. Okt 2020
Beiträge
15.028
Punkte für Reaktionen
5.401
Punkte
564
Ich würde auch mal eine ältere AudioStation Version und auf dem Handy versuchen
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Keine Ahnung, noch so ein Apfel-Jünger.

Eines kann ich aber sicher sagen: Ich denke, der Synology-Support wird angesichts der Sammlung veralteter Betriebssysteme nur die Schultern Zucken und sagen „Erst mal Updates einspielen“. DSM 6.2 steht vor dem Supportende, Android 10 ist ziemlich Vintage.

Vielleicht findest du tatsächlich hier jemanden, der ähnlich weit zurück unterwegs ist, und dann auch noch Audio Station zum offline-Download zu motivieren versucht - wäre ein Glückstreffer.
Es darf auch eine neuere DiskStation und ein Android 13 getestet werden.
Vielleicht zeigt sich dort ja das selbe Verhalten. Dann würde ein Umstieg für mich wenig Sinn machen.
 

Thorfinn

Benutzer
Sehr erfahren
Mitglied seit
24. Mai 2019
Beiträge
1.744
Punkte für Reaktionen
417
Punkte
103
Ich kann den Fehler hier nicht reproduzieren. Habe aber weder eine so alte DS noch eine Android Telefon.
Ausserdem habe ich die cover in den id3 tags und nicht als cover.jpg nebenbei.
Letzteres wäre ein workaround, aber keine Fehlerbehebung.
Bemerkst du den Fehler auch bei anderen Telefonen / versionen von DS Audio?
 
Mitglied seit
06. Aug 2023
Beiträge
14
Punkte für Reaktionen
1
Punkte
3
Die Cover befinden sich bei mir ebenfalls in den ID3 Tags. Habe diese nirgends extra bewusst hingespeichert.

Derzeit ist die aktuellste DS Audio auf der DiskStation installiert. Könnte ggf. auf eine ältere Version zurückgehen. Aktuelle DiskStation mit DSM 7 hab ich keine. Ein Umstieg auf eine aktuelle würde sich für mich nur lohnen, wenn der Fehler dort nicht existiert, da ich meine DS nur als AudioStation nutze.

Smartphone/Tablet müsste ich ein anderes testen.
 

Thonav

Benutzer
Sehr erfahren
Mitglied seit
16. Feb 2014
Beiträge
7.890
Punkte für Reaktionen
1.510
Punkte
274
Dann versuch es doch mal mit einem Update auf DSM 7.xxx
 


 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at